Can I lease an Apple laptop?

Yes, you can lease an Apple laptop through Apple’s financing program or through third-party leasing companies. Leasing allows you to pay a monthly fee for a set period of time, typically two to three years, before returning the laptop or purchasing it at the end of the lease.

Leasing an Apple laptop can be a convenient option for those who want the latest technology without the high upfront cost of buying a new laptop. It also allows for predictable monthly payments and the option to upgrade to a new model at the end of the lease term.

What are the benefits of leasing an Apple laptop?

Benefits of leasing an Apple laptop include access to the latest technology, predictable monthly payments, the option to upgrade to a new model at the end of the lease term, and potential tax benefits for businesses.

Can I lease an Apple laptop with bad credit?

Some leasing companies may offer options for those with less-than-perfect credit, but it may come with higher interest rates or additional fees. It’s best to check with individual leasing companies for their credit requirements.

Can I buy my leased Apple laptop at the end of the lease term?

Yes, most leasing programs offer the option to purchase the leased laptop at the end of the lease term for an additional cost. This can be a good option if you’ve grown attached to the laptop or want to keep it for personal or business use.

Can I return my leased Apple laptop before the end of the lease term?

Returning a leased Apple laptop before the end of the lease term may incur early termination fees. It’s best to check the terms and conditions of your lease agreement before making any decisions.

Are there tax benefits to leasing an Apple laptop?

Businesses may be able to deduct the monthly lease payments as a business expense, potentially offering tax benefits. Individuals should consult with a tax professional for specific guidance on their tax situation.

Can I choose the length of my Apple laptop lease?

Yes, leasing companies typically offer a range of lease term options, usually ranging from two to three years. You can choose the length of the lease based on your budget and how frequently you want to upgrade your laptop.

Can I lease multiple Apple laptops at once?

Yes, some leasing companies may allow you to lease multiple Apple laptops at once, depending on your creditworthiness and the terms of the lease agreement. This can be a convenient option for businesses or individuals who need multiple laptops for different purposes.

Can I customize my leased Apple laptop?

Some leasing companies may offer the option to customize your leased Apple laptop with additional upgrades or accessories for an extra cost. It’s best to check with the leasing company for available customization options.

What happens if my leased Apple laptop is damaged?

Most lease agreements will include terms for damage and repairs, which may require you to pay for repairs or replacement of damaged parts. It’s important to take good care of your leased laptop to avoid additional costs at the end of the lease term.
